Elastomer Bonding 101

For years the task of joining two disparate materials into a single unit was done through different methods, one of which was indium bonding. The main drawback of this (and related methods) was when materials with varying coefficient of thermal expansion (CTE) were bonded together for an application - such as a ceramic plate with a metallic base. When these components were put into a high operating temperature the CTE mismatch would stress the bond layer, cracking or severing it.

Refurbishment

Under normal operating conditions, ion implanter process wheels are subject to considerable wear, damage and particulate contamination. To ensure optimal performance and yield, these tools require a regimen of scheduled maintenance. At STS, the refurbishment process for these tools include complete disassembly, decontamination, repair, replacement of worn parts and broken components, reassembly and extensive functional testing.

Decontamination

Each wheel undergoes careful initial inspection for damaged parts as well as for overall wheel condition. The decontamination process includes hydrohoning each wheel, heat sink and part with a low-pressure abrasive slurry. All components are then meticulously refinished using a highly specialized process to improve surface quality.

Coating & Repair

Refurbishment includes a complex process in which each heat sink is coated with a thin layer of elastomer, specifically formulated for a finely tuned rheology. This material is designed to create a more effective thermal interface for the wafer. All replacement parts are manufactured onsite in our CNC-equipped machine shop. Prior to assembly, components undergo an ultrasonic cleaning plus two DI rinses in our class 1,000 cleanroom. Extensive testing takes place at each step of reassembly to insure precise tolerances. After final assembly, each wheel is checked again for functionality and balanced to +/- 1 gram or less at operating speed. Prior to delivery, wheels are double bagged in class 100 packaging. At the customers option, special gas filled 'clean' shipping containers are available.

Precision Cleaning

In an effort to help our customers streamline their supply chains STS offers a full range of precision cleaning services for components and finished assemblies. These include extensive processes for cleaning new and refurbished etch and implant components & multiple substrates and comprehensive post cleaning surface analysis.

Cleaning Facilities and Equipment

During the cleaning process STS takes many precautions to ensure that cross contamination is avoided while processing components. All in-process and final cleaning areas are fully segregated for contamination control. The STS cleaning process begins in a class 10,000 clean room where incoming inspection and initial cleaning steps are performed. Surface critical cleaning, baking, final inspection and vacuum seal packaging processes are completed in a Class 100 clean room.

Processing Techniques

STS uses a Single use bath batch processing that utilizes semiconductor grade chemicals and clean room qualified materials. All process conditions are controlled, monitored and documented using process travelers to ensure optimum surface integrity of cleaned components.

Post Cleaning Surface Analysis

In addition to industry leading process, materials and environmental control on our cleaning processes, STS has the added capabilities for examining the surface of a cleaned part. These include:

  • CMM dimensional measurement
  • Surface profilometer measurement
  • Eddy current meters for coating thickness
  • SEM high magnification for grain boundary imaging
  • UV black light inspection for non-visual contamination
